Snow Track Racing 3D game allows you to explore the most exciting car racing simulation experience while drifting over the heavily snowed car racing tracks. Unlike other snow drifting games, this car drift game has real snow drifting while driving new and luxurious formula cars on asphalt tracks. Enjoy the cool car racing games for free and become the champion of online racing car games.
Cute Dogs Jigsaw
Drag Racing
Marble Rolling Stunt
Face Paint
Little Dino Adventure Returns
Pixel Circuit Racing Car Crash GM
ZombieCraft 2
Paw Patrol Smash
FZ Pixel Jumper
Puzzleguys Hearts
Airplane Fight
Knife Ninja
Bowling Fun 2019
Pottery
Bounce & Roll!
Metro Bus Simulator
BMW 1-Series UK Puzzle
Fun Animals Jigsaw
Magic World
Santa Claus Gift Challenge
Sonic.io
Princess Sweet Candy Cosplay
Candy Block
Elsa - Wedding Hairdresser For Princesses
Air Fight
Talking Tom Funny Time
The Impossible Dash
FZ Jet Halloween
Arkanoid For Painters
Stupid Zombies Hunt